During review of the Larkspur ingest refactor, I noticed three transitive dependencies resolve to floating minor versions, which violates our stated pinning policy. Please verify that the lockfile regeneration script now pins every runtime dependency to an exact version, and that the CI gate rejects any range specifiers. I've rebuilt the candidate artifact with the strict resolver enabled and confirmed reproducibility across two clean runners. For verification, the resulting build token is recorded below.

build token for yajof-bajof: htk31_506ff1188f74596b5bb2eec94edc43c

Management Meeting Minutes — Brightvale Systems

Welcome aboard! Quick recap for you: we agreed to move legacy Kestrel Suite customers off grandfathered pricing starting next quarter. Marnie flagged churn risk among the Oakhollow accounts, so we'll phase it over six months with a goodwill credit. Devon will draft the comms; nothing goes out until you've signed off. Expect pushback from the longest-tenured folks. Full pricing model is in the shared folder. One more thing before you dig in.

board note of bawep-tajef: Queniusek Systems plans to raise the Quenvan list price by 53.1 percent in March. The pricing group signed off on a budget of $176.4 million for Project Drueth. The renewal with Casionix Partners closes at $142.5 million a year, 8.3 percent below the last contract. Project Fraax slips by six weeks because of the tooling delay.

The committee reviewed exposure arising from Talverian crown receivables, now 30% of inflows. After examining forward-contract quotes and the treasury model, members approved hedging 70% of projected twelve-month exposure, reviewed quarterly. Vesta will brief branch managers on invoicing procedures; Kirrin documents counterparty limits. The decision takes effect next settlement cycle. Branch-level questions go through regional finance. Rationale touching on wider plans is recorded in the confidential note below.

board note of tadup-tajog: Headcount on the Oliiel team goes from 31 to 88 by the end of February. Gross margin on Oliiel came in at 62 percent against a plan of 29 percent.